What is Satoshi Protocol?
Satoshi Protocol is the first Collateralized Debt Position (CDP) protocol built on the BEVM Layer 2 blockchain. It allows users to deposit their Bitcoin as collateral and mint $SAT, a stablecoin pegged to the US dollar. This essentially enables users to borrow against their Bitcoin holdings to access liquidity for various purposes, such as trading or earning interest on other DeFi platforms.
How Does Satoshi Protocol Work?
Satoshi Protocol leverages several key features:
BEVM Layer 2: By building on BEVM, Satoshi Protocol benefits from faster transaction speeds and lower fees compared to the main Bitcoin network.
Collateralized Debt Positions (CDPs): Users deposit their Bitcoin into a CDP, locking it as collateral. They can then borrow a specific amount of $SAT, the stablecoin, based on a predefined loan-to-value (LTV) ratio.
Maintaining Bitcoin Exposure: Unlike some DeFi lending protocols that convert collateral to other cryptocurrencies, Satoshi Protocol allows users to maintain exposure to Bitcoin's potential price appreciation while accessing liquidity.
Stablecoin Borrowing: By borrowing $SAT, a USD-pegged stablecoin, users avoid the volatility associated with borrowing other cryptocurrencies.
Can Satoshi Protocol Succeed?
While Satoshi Protocol offers a compelling solution for Bitcoin holders seeking liquidity, some challenges need to be addressed:
Competition: Established DeFi platforms already offer various lending and borrowing options. Satoshi Protocol needs to carve out a distinct niche within the market.
BEVM Adoption: The success of Satoshi Protocol hinges on the wider adoption of the BEVM Layer 2 solution.
Smart Contract Risks: As with any DeFi protocol, the security of smart contracts is paramount. Satoshi Protocol needs to prioritize thorough audits and security measures.
